In 2006 .... there will be at least TWO RIDE-IN's :
Scratch in your dates.
Tiger Ride-In HIAWASSEE
June 8-10 2006: Hiawassee, GA in North Georgia.
Our event will coincide with the British in the Blue Ridge Rally of vintage British bikes.
This town of 800 is nestled in the Appalachian Mtns loaded with sightseeing, waterfalls, twisties, and
forest trails for atv & motorcycles.
Camping & hoteling. Hqtrs: Holiday Inn Express
I hope to pull 100 Tigers for this event!
Tiger Ride-In DURANGO
Sept 14 -16 2006: DURANGO, Colorado
This town of about 12,000 is nestled within short rides of 8,000ft - 11,000ft+ passes that can leave
you gasping for air! Some passes are simply 'trails' while others are pavement. But trying to to total
100,000ft in 2 days will be an accomplishment.
Or ride on down to Mesa Verde and gaze at cliff dwellings and 100's of miles Mother Earth. The sky is
so black it is like velvet. The riding is the stories you will tell for years to come.
The weather will be in the 70's; The leaves will be changing; And the scenery will overwhelm you!
